I don't know about the Chimera question, but here is how to load
existing data into an array channel. Say you have five channels of data
labelled "chan_1" to "chan_5". To load the data into a new channel called
"chan_array", do the following:

1) open a new channel called "chan_array" and specify the Array Size as 5
2) create a math expression file (.EXP) as follows:
   chan_array[0]=chan_1; chan_array[1]=chan_2; chan_array[2]=chan_3;
   chan_array[3]=chan_4; chan_array[4]=chan_5;
3) run the math expression
4) in the new array channel, you should see the five elements visually
   displayed    

Don't forget that the first element in an array channel has an index of
[0].
